Nevada's oldest state park dazzles with vibrant red sandstone formations and ancient petroglyphs. Explore iconic sites like the Fire Wave and Elephant Rock, best experienced during the golden light of early morning.
The Lost City Museum preserves ancient Puebloan culture with artifacts dating back to 300 B.C. Explore reconstructed dwellings and view pottery collections while enjoying scenic views of the Moapa Valley.
Ancient petroglyphs and red sandstone formations tell the story of Nevada's desert wilderness. Explore this remote sanctuary with a high-clearance vehicle and plenty of water for the ultimate outdoor adventure.
Ancient petroglyphs adorn red sandstone walls along this scenic desert trail in Valley of Fire State Park. The sandy path leads to Mouse's Tank, a natural basin collecting rainwater in the arid landscape.
